Greektown
There is always a party in Greektown. Home to several restaurants and the Greektown Casino, those in search of a nightlife that never disappoints in Greektown. Detroit considered the center of entertainment, is the center of the most vibrant city. Monroe Street is full of authentic Greek, American and ethnic restaurants, shops, clubs and more. restaurants largest area, Fishbones Rhythm Kitchen Cajun cuisine and sushi, along with live entertainment. A local favorite Irish-themed 30 years, the Shillelagh is the place for live music and tasty Irish bar food.

Of course, if the casino action is your thing, Detroit has a total of three casinos in three regions other than the city. party gaining momentum in the Greektown Casino, with the introduction of a new hotel in 2008. The stunning 30-story hotel is complemented by 100,000 square foot of gaming space, a 1100 seat live theater, and two new restaurants. Greektown Casino is within walking distance of Comerica Park, Ford Field, Fox Theatre

The recently opened MGM Grand Detroit offers games in an elegant and sophisticated – complete with a profusion of restaurants and lounges as well as a hotel of 401 rooms. aptly named casino in Detroit, Motor City Casino Detroit embraces its local, putting a stylish spin on the topic Las Vegas automotive. Motor City has also recently opened a 17-story, 400 room hotel.

Pontiac
Pontiac center is always full of energy. As the northern terminus for the Woodward Dream Cruise, Pontiac attracts nearly 500,000 people who see classic cars per unit, and get a close look at hundreds of cars on display.

For a spin late in the evening, head to the singles Clutch Cargo, a church in the late nineteenth century. With superb acoustics, the club and brought to the likes of Foo Fighters, Less Than Jake, Aphex Twin, and The Brian Setzer Orchestra. Too rigid bodies to the alternative, disco, funk, dance and music of Motown in numerous stories. Also in Pontiac, tonic night club at various levels with a wide variety of music spun by popular DJ in the area.

Novi
With a combination of retro accents and modern technology, Lucky Strike Lanes in Novi is the area of a bowling hall first, with more 200 video games, basketball hoops, pool tables, dance floor, and ways the state of the art of bowling. Inside the colossal place VIP Lounge, a 40-foot bar serves an endless list of drinks and a menu featuring signature tomato and cheese s'mores, pizzas, and abundant Lucky Burger. Only children and adolescents during the day, Lucky Strike is transformed in the active zone adult after 9 pm for the over 21 crowd only sport business suit
